要確定博客網(wǎng)站在遭受幾十萬(wàn)次攻擊時(shí)所涉及的流量大小,需要考慮幾個(gè)關(guān)鍵因素,包括每次攻擊請(qǐng)求的數(shù)據(jù)量、攻擊的類型以及攻擊的持續(xù)時(shí)間。以下是一些常見(jiàn)的攻擊類型和估算方法:
常見(jiàn)攻擊類型及其數(shù)據(jù)量
1. HTTP Flood攻擊:
- 這種攻擊通過(guò)發(fā)送大量的HTTP請(qǐng)求來(lái)淹沒(méi)服務(wù)器。
- 每個(gè)HTTP請(qǐng)求的數(shù)據(jù)量通常在幾百字節(jié)到幾千字節(jié)之間。例如,一個(gè)簡(jiǎn)單的GET請(qǐng)求可能只有幾百字節(jié),而帶有大量參數(shù)的POST請(qǐng)求可能達(dá)到幾千字節(jié)。
2. TCP SYN Flood攻擊:
- 這種攻擊通過(guò)發(fā)送大量的TCP SYN包來(lái)耗盡服務(wù)器的連接資源。
- 每個(gè)SYN包的數(shù)據(jù)量通常在幾十到幾百字節(jié)之間。
3. UDP Flood攻擊:
- 通過(guò)發(fā)送大量的UDP數(shù)據(jù)包來(lái)消耗網(wǎng)絡(luò)帶寬和服務(wù)器資源。
- 每個(gè)UDP包的數(shù)據(jù)量可以從幾十字節(jié)到幾千字節(jié)不等。
估算方法
假設(shè)我們以HTTP Flood攻擊為例進(jìn)行估算:
1. 每次請(qǐng)求的數(shù)據(jù)量:
- 假設(shè)每個(gè)HTTP請(qǐng)求的數(shù)據(jù)量為500字節(jié)(這是一個(gè)合理的平均值)。
2. 總請(qǐng)求數(shù):
- 假設(shè)攻擊次數(shù)為100,000次。
3. 總數(shù)據(jù)量:
- 總數(shù)據(jù)量 = 每次請(qǐng)求的數(shù)據(jù)量 × 總請(qǐng)求數(shù)
- 總數(shù)據(jù)量 = 500字節(jié)/請(qǐng)求 × 100,000請(qǐng)求 = 50,000,000字節(jié)
4. 轉(zhuǎn)換為GB:
- 1 GB = 1,073,741,824字節(jié)
- 總數(shù)據(jù)量 (GB) = 50,000,000字節(jié) / 1,073,741,824字節(jié)/GB ≈ 0.0466 GB
因此,在這種情況下,幾十萬(wàn)次的攻擊大約會(huì)產(chǎn)生0.0466 GB的數(shù)據(jù)量。
其他因素
- 攻擊持續(xù)時(shí)間:
- 如果攻擊持續(xù)時(shí)間較長(zhǎng),可能會(huì)產(chǎn)生更多的數(shù)據(jù)量。例如,如果攻擊持續(xù)一個(gè)小時(shí),每秒發(fā)送1000次請(qǐng)求,那么總數(shù)據(jù)量會(huì)更大。
- 攻擊強(qiáng)度:
- 攻擊強(qiáng)度越高,單位時(shí)間內(nèi)發(fā)送的請(qǐng)求數(shù)越多,產(chǎn)生的數(shù)據(jù)量也越大。
實(shí)際應(yīng)用
在實(shí)際中,DDoS攻擊的流量大小可以非常大,尤其是在大規(guī)模攻擊的情況下。例如,一些大型DDoS攻擊可以達(dá)到數(shù)百Gbps甚至Tbps的規(guī)模。因此,如果你的博客網(wǎng)站經(jīng)常遭受攻擊,建議采取以下措施:
1. 使用CDN服務(wù):
- 例如,Cloudflare提供了ddos防護(hù)功能,可以幫助吸收和緩解攻擊流量。
2. 配置防火墻和安全組:
- 使用云服務(wù)提供商的安全組和防火墻規(guī)則來(lái)限制不必要的流量。
3. 監(jiān)控和日志分析:
- 定期監(jiān)控和分析日志,及時(shí)發(fā)現(xiàn)并應(yīng)對(duì)異常流量。
4. DDoS防護(hù)服務(wù):
- 考慮使用專業(yè)的DDoS防護(hù)服務(wù),如恒創(chuàng)科技高防等。
通過(guò)這些措施,你可以更好地保護(hù)你的博客網(wǎng)站免受DDoS攻擊的影響。